EXIF scrubbing (Pixelmoor upload pipeline). All inbound images pass through the scrub worker before hitting public storage. The worker strips GPS, serial, and timestamp tags but preserves orientation. If scrubbed counts drop to zero while uploads continue, the sidecar has likely crashed — quarantine the unscrubbed bucket immediately. Do not bypass the scrubber, even for internal tooling. Recovery steps are documented on the page below.

runbook for taduf-kawef: https://confluence.qorvelsys.internal/projects/display/display/pages

**ALERT: TrailScribe offline queue exceeding threshold**

Fires when a field-survey device holds more than 500 unsynced records in offline mode. Usually means sync tokens expired while surveyors were out of coverage. Do not purge the queue — records are unrecoverable. Force a token refresh from the device admin panel instead. Triage steps for this alert are documented here:

operations page: https://confluence.tolvaqsys.corp/spaces/pages/pages/6e787158f507

SDK Parity: Quickref

The Lumekit Swift and Kotlin SDKs target feature parity each release. Check the parity matrix before promising anything to integrators. Known gaps: offline queueing (Kotlin only), biometric unlock (Swift only). Gaps must have a tracking ticket or they don't exist. Parity regressions block release. For parity questions, reach the SDK platform desk here.

escalation mailbox, bafog-fafog: ulador@paliqlabs.internal